摘要
近年来,作为一种新兴系统工程方法,基于模型的系统工程(MBSE)的相关研究及应用迅速扩展,已成为美欧军事强国进行国防工业数字化转型的重要抓手,受到政府机构、军工企业的广泛关注。本文首先介绍了美军在政策制度引导、组织机构保障等方面有序推动MBSE发展的政策管理举措;其次,从提升武器系统研制管理能力、提升武器系统多学科协同优化设计能力、加速国防军工数字化转型三个方面分析了MBSE在国外武器系统研制中的应用现状,从建模手段、模型数据来源、应用范围三方面总结凝练出MBSE的发展重点;最后从政府部门统一谋划、培育MBSE发展文化等方面提出了启示与建议。
In recent years,Model-Based Systems Engineering(MBSE)related studies and applications have developed rapidly,becoming an essential breakthrough for the digital transformation of defense industries in the United States and European military powers.Thus,MBSE related studies have received extensive attention from corresponding government agencies and military enterprises.This paper firstly introduces the policy management measures taken by the U.S.military to promote the development of MBSE in terms of guidance through the policy system and guarantees for organizations and institutions.Secondly,the application status of MBSE in developing weapon systems in other countries is analyzed from three aspects:improving the management capabilities of weapon system development,enhancing the capabilities of multidisciplinary collaborative optimization design of weapon systems,and accelerating the digital transformation of the national defense industry.Finally,the enlightenment and suggestions for China are proposed considering the aspects of unified planning by government departments,implementing pilot applications,and cultivating a culture of MBSE development.
